They cloned luxury cars from San Marino to avoid paying VAT, 25 reported in Naples
La Polstrada has discovered a traffic of cloned cars in the Neapolitan area: they arrived as they arrived from San Marino in order not to pay VAT. Report 25 people.

The cars were all from San Marino, where there is an 8% VAT on the purchase, totally zeroed for re-registrations in Italy thanks to agreements between the two states. In reality, the vehicles, many of them valuable, did come from abroad, but from other nations, and they were gods clones of vehicles circulating in the small republic. The traffic was reconstructed by the Traffic Police of the Campania-Basilicata Compartment thanks to cross-checks on the cars, with which the “duplication” was discovered first and then the system devised to defraud the state.
The investigations were born when the documents for a re-registration of a car arrived on the table of the Motorization of Naples and which seemed to have been counterfeited. The investigations then started and it turned out that that same car was, at least apparently, still in San Marino. It was clearly a clone. Hence the targeted checks on other vehicles that had passed the same process, which led to the identification of 27 carsincluding luxury SUVs such as Porsche Macane, Audi Q2, Q3, SQ5, A3 Sportback, Range Rover Evoque and even sedans such as BMW Coupè, Mercedes A180D and 200D and numerous other cars for tens of thousands of euros.
By ascertaining the real origin of the vehicles, the agents ascertained that many come from Germany. With this mechanism, implemented thanks to the complicity of some Vesuvian car practice agencies, re-registrations took place without paying the 22% VAT due for importation. The operation led to a report on the loose for 25 people, held responsible, in concert with each other, for fraud and false attestation to a public official.
